1953: The USAF decided to adopt SAGE (MIT’s Lincoln Laboratory electronic defense system) instead of the Air Defense Integrated System (ADIS) development. The basic SAGE architecture was cleanly summarized in the preface to a seminal 1953 technical memo written by George Valley and Jay Forrester: Lincoln Laboratory Technical Memorandum No. 20, A Proposal for Air Defense System Evolution: The Transition Phase.
